Hawkleys 2010 season continued with the annual visit from the Staggerers, an occasional side drawn from several local clubs.
Having lost the toss and been invited to bat, Hawkley confused the scorers by sending out two batsmen both named Nick Davis. Club chairman Nick Davis was swiftly off the mark with a boundary in the first over before falling to a good ball from Hannam however his namesake batted well in combination with Usmar and a good partnership developed until the second Davis fell with the score on fifty. Incoming batsmen Burkie gave a taste of what was to come by hitting his first ball for six and the score advanced rapidly until Usmar was stumped for 31. The arrival of the left-handed Dinnis was a signal for the real carnage to start: Burkie’s hard hitting complementing the languid elegance of Dinnis as the pair put on 150 runs in a very short time. The pair accelerated as Burkie neared his century which he reached with a boundary after which he retired. Dinnis was bowled shortly afterwards for 65 and the Hawkley innings closed on 267.
The Staggerers reply started strongly until Davis 2 bowled Turner. Mullard bowling from the other end took an excellent catch off his own bowling to dismiss Hannam before dismissing Holman second ball. The Staggerers regrouped as Wren joined Webber and a good stand developed until Burkie came on to bowl and immediately removed Webber for an excellent fifty and Mears for a duck. Thereafter the Staggerers concentrated on survival and the scoring rate slowed as wickets fell regularly until the Staggerers ran out of overs on 196 for 8 with Wren undefeated on 55.
This was an excellent game with good individual performances on both sides capped by Burkie’s century.
